WebU.S.-based companies or sole proprietors operating as Ocean Freight Forwarders (OFF) or Non-Vessel-Operating Common Carriers (NVOCCs) are required to obtain a license from the FMC. Non-U.S.-based NVOCCs may obtain a registration or license from the FMC. Freight forwarders must at all times maintain a $5,000 cargo insurance … jason styve insuranceWebThe freight forwarder (also known as shipping and forwarding agents) doesn’t actually move the goods but handles the logistics of their movement. This involves relationships with various shippers, by land (trucks and railroads), air and water.
